Compatible Speakers When you want your Jeep JK speakers upgrade ensure that audio components such as the amplifier and subwoofer are not mismatched. If they are mismatched, new equipment can be damaged. Poor sound quality can also be caused by incompatible subwoofers and amplifiers, which occur when the amp either overpowers or underpowers the subwoofer. Underpowering speakers or subwoofers, as well as excessive overpowering, can result in product damage; a common defect we find is burnt voice coils as a result of mismatched items. 3. Selecting the Best Style for You The buyer has the choice of a full-range audio system or a component system in Jeep. Full-range speakers are a fundamental system in which all components, including tweeters, subwoofers, and super tweeters, are contained in a single group. On both front doors, a single speaker group is fitted. People prefer these since they are less expensive, easier to install, and take up less room. If you mostly listen to audiobooks, radio, and podcasts, you won’t notice much of a difference. Imaging, spatial correction, and precise tuning are all critical. Turning up the treble, bass, and mid-range levels, on the other hand, does not improve the car audio system. It can, in fact, be quite the reverse. To some extent, these changes may sound fantastic in your driveway. When the automobile is moving, though, it usually only adds distortion. Without diving into too many specifics, the fundamental concept is that the fewer tonal adjustments made, the better.
